Descriptions
The Children and Families service at the London Borough of Hackney is preparing for the upcoming procurement of an Independent Visitor Service, with an anticipated contract start date of 1st January 2027 for a minimum period of 5 years. We invite organisations from the voluntary, community, and independent sectors to attend a market engagement event for providers who may be interested in submitting a tender for this service. About the Service We are seeking providers to work in partnership with the Local Authority to deliver a high-quality Independent Visitors service for Children that are looked after. Successful providers must be committed to embedding Systemic, Trauma Informed and Anti Racist Practice within their service delivery, promoting psychological safety, inclusion, and collaboration with children and families. This engagement will inform the commissioning and procurement process, which is focused on driving up quality and improving outcomes in line with Hackney’s statutory duties under the Children Act 1989, Children and Families Act 2014, and Equality Act 2010. The Event will take place virtually over the Google Meets Platform on Tuesday 24th February 2026 between 10:00am and 11:00am How to Register Your Interest Interested organisations are invited to register their interest in attending the event: Via the portal by completing and uploading the short questionnaire before the deadline Questionnaire The closing date for expressions of interest is Tuesday 17th February at 12pm.
